Freet rides the cushion for Lake County Win
By Shawn Neisteadt
(September 6, 2003-Madison, SD) Scott Freet used the high groove to motor his way past Gary Brown, Jr in the Late Model Stock Car feature to take the win. While in the Super Stock feature it was all Brian Diede.
Brown pulled into the lead at the drop of the green flag in the Late Model Stock Car feature. The yellow waved with four laps counted as Chris Ellingson spun and collected Rob Anderson. The yellow waved again one lap later when the third place car, Al Barnhardt, spun in turn two. That moved Scott Freet into third place. As the green dropped once again, Freet went to the outside and took second from Matt Steuerwald. Freet then used the high side of the track to catch Brown who was running on the bottom of the track. On the tenth lap Freet was able to pull alongside the race leader. On the eleventh lap of the race Freet inched his way into the lead as they came off turn two. The race was still far from over though. Brown battled back and into the lead off turn four, but the momentum of the high side put Freet back into the lead at the flag stand. That was important as they yellow soon waved again when the #3 of Steuerwald spun.
The race was then set up for a two lap dash to the checkereds between Freet and Brown. Just as before each stuck to their groove with Freet upstairs and Brown on the short way around. They raced side by side to the finish where it was Freet taking his second win of the year. Brown took second and third went to Rick Goth. JJ Zebell finished fourth and Mark DeBoer rounded out the top five.
The Super Stocks made their second appearance of the season at Lake County Speedway. The 15 lap feature was all Brian Diede as he led the entire distance for the win. Charlie Bloomenrader was second and third went to Lorin Johnson. Ross Dixon took fourth place and Greg Keppen rounded out the top five. The yellow waved once in the feature when the #21 of Russ Phillips slammed the front stretch wall and slowed on the track.
Mike Forseth led the first four laps of the Sportsmen feature but lost the handle on the fourth lap in turn two and spun out. From that point on it was Matt Ayres as he led the rest of the way to take his third win of the year. Daryl Reverts was second and third went to Jamie Tieszen. Kevin Spurgin came back from a flat tire that he received from an incident with four laps to go and finished fourth. Don Gerritsen, Jr raced his way to a fifth place finish.
Justin Olson had the early race lead of the Hobby Stock feature, but it only took four laps for Mike McGillivray to charge from tenth to challenge for that lead. McGillivray took the lead in the first turn on the fourth lap. Coming off the second turn McGillivray and Olson made contact sending both cars into the wall. That took out both of the top two cars and handed the lead to Nick Bahr. Bahr made the most of the present and took home his third win of the season at Lake County. Travis Johnson was second and third went to Darren Duffy. Lane Brenden was fourth and Andy Hanson rounded out the top five.
After a few failed attempts to get the Wild Ones feature under way, Tara Johnson took the lead. Brian Heimen then took the lead on the final restart of the race and went of for his third win of the year. Leslie Arnett was second and third went to Skeeter Hanson. Johnson was fourth and Greg Jung took fifth.
Myron Prussman took his fourth win of the year in Deuces Wild action. Shawn Callies was second and third went to Chad Larson. Dave Kennedy was fourth and Jim Klutman rounded out the top five.
Lake County Speedway hosts the NMRA Nationals on Sunday September 7. The season wraps up on Saturday September 13 with championships for the stock cars. The Outlaw Sprints make their annual appearance on championship night as well.
